ACM Research reported Q2 2026 revenue of $292.9 million, a 36% year-over-year increase that sent shares up 15.8% and prompted the company to raise full-year guidance to $1.125 billion–$1.175 billion. Electroplating (ECP) surged 168%. Advanced packaging jumped 153%. Management cited strong order activity, a $4 billion long-term revenue target, and the milestone of shipping its 2,000th electroplating chamber.

The headline numbers tell a demand story. The segment breakdown tells a different one. ACM Research's legacy cleaning business—the category that carried 72% of revenue just one year ago—declined 14% year-over-year in Q2 2026. The 36% top-line growth is not a broad-based expansion. It is a product-mix pivot, and the margin, inventory, and cash-flow mechanics of that pivot have not yet been fully reflected in the stock.

The Revenue Split: What's Growing and What's Shrinking

The data below shows the shift.


SegmentQ2 2025 RevenueQ2 2026 RevenueYoY ChangeShare of Revenue (Q2 2025)Share of Revenue (Q2 2026)
Single wafer & Tahoe cleaning$155.0M$133.0M-14.2%72%45%
ECP, furnace & other$48.0M$128.5M+167.7%22%44%
Advanced packaging (excl. ECP)$12.4M$31.4M+153.3%6%11%
Total$215.4M$292.9M+36.0%100%100%

The cleaning decline is the structural signal. ACM ResearchACMR-- built its business on single-wafer and Tahoe cleaning equipment. That category has been ACMR's durable cash engine and its primary source of market share gains in China. A 14% contraction means the company's core installed base and repeat-order cycle is under pressure, at least in the short term. Management attributed the decline to the timing of new SPM (single plasma megasonic) tool revenue recognition—only a handful of SPM units shipped in H1 2026, and SPM represents roughly one-third of the total cleaning market. More than 20 SPM tools are expected to ship in H2. That timeline matters, but it also means the cleaning rebound is deferred, not immediate.

Meanwhile, the ECP and advanced packaging categories that are carrying total revenue growth are still in their commercial ramp. The ECP segment crossed $128 million in a single quarter for the first time, but it is a lower-margin category in its early qualification phase. The implication is straightforward: ACM Research is trading a mature, higher-margin cleaning business for a fast-growing, lower-margin electroplating and packaging mix.

Margin and Inventory: The Cost of Transition

Gross margin fell to 46.0% in Q2 2026, down from 48.7% a year ago. The company maintains a long-term target range of 42%–48%, and 46.0% sits inside that band. But the compression is not noise. It reflects two forces: rising component costs and the shift toward new product categories that carry lower initial margins. Management noted that component lead times have stretched from four months to six months, particularly for parts sourced from Japan and Korea. Suppliers are delaying shipments rather than raising prices—at least for now—but the constraint is real and it will test pricing discipline if it persists.

Inventory is where the transition becomes visible. Net inventory reached $783.1 million at the end of Q2, up from roughly $738 million trailing twelve months. The composition tells the story: raw materials of $406.1 million, work in progress of $89.0 million, and finished goods of $287.9 million.

The $288 million in finished goods is the critical line item. Management explained that most of it consists of first tools sitting at customer sites under evaluation, not unsold backlog. That is functionally accurate but also a distinction without a difference from a cash-conversion standpoint: tools at customer sites are not generating revenue until acceptance occurs, and acceptance cycles can extend unpredictably. Shipment growth is expected to outpace revenue growth in 2026, which is management's way of acknowledging that the gap between tools delivered and revenue recognized will widen through the second half.

Customer concentration has improved—one customer accounted for 12.7% of H1 2026 revenue, compared to three customers representing 49.9% in H1 2025. That deconcentration is a positive sign of a broader customer base, but it does not offset the inventory build or the margin compression during the product-mix transition.

Cash Flow and Capex: Burning Through the Transition

The balance sheet remains solid. Net cash was $1.0 billion at June 30, 2026, with total cash, equivalents, and time deposits at $1.36 billion. Approximately $300 million of that is held on the U.S. balance sheet following a May 2026 registered direct offering.

But free cash flow is deeply negative. Trailing twelve-month free cash flow came in at -$119.8 million, a decline of 579% year-over-year. Operating cash flow for the TTM period was -$6.6 million, against capital expenditures of $113.2 million. Full-year 2026 capex is guided at approximately $175 million, and management confirmed on the call that the company expects to burn cash in 2026, with positive cash flow deferred to the longer term.

This is not a margin-cutting cycle. It is a capital-intensive product ramp. The company is simultaneously building out an Oregon demo center (opening Q4 2026), expanding a 1 million-square-foot R&D and production facility in Lingang, China, and qualifying four new product platforms: SPM cleaning, Track, PECVD, and horizontal panel-level plating. The $1.0 billion net cash position provides runway, but it also means the stock is pricing in a successful conversion from cash burn to cash generation before the mechanics of that conversion are proven.

At a $5.79 billion market cap and 63.6x trailing earnings, ACM Research trades at a premium to the semiconductor equipment average despite negative free cash flow and a declining core business. Applied Materials trades at 50.3x PE with positive cash generation and a diversified portfolio. Lam Research is at 53.6x with the same profile. ACMR's valuation assumes the product-mix pivot will execute smoothly, margins will hold within the 42%–48% band, and the cleaning business will stabilize as SPM ramps. Any one of those assumptions slipping extends the cash-burn period and pressures the multiple.

The Panel-Level Gambit

The most forward-looking signal from the quarter was the receipt of two orders for the Ultra ECP ap-p horizontal panel-level electroplating tool: a production order for one 510 × 515 mm tool from an existing advanced packaging customer in mainland China, with delivery scheduled for the first half of 2027, and an evaluation order for one 310 × 310 mm tool from a new leading panel manufacturer in Asia, with delivery in Q4 2026.

Panel-level packaging is the structural play here. As advanced packaging moves beyond wafer-level formats toward larger panels (510 × 515 mm and 600 × 600 mm), horizontal electroplating systems become a requirement for deposition uniformity at scale. ACM Research is positioning itself as the first to commercialize this tool. But the timeline is back-loaded: the production order does not ship until H1 2027, and the evaluation order is still in qualification. Revenue from panel-level plating will not appear on the income statement until those tools are delivered and accepted, which places it well beyond the current guidance window.

Investor Takeaway

ACM Research's Q2 2026 results are not a broad-based demand story. They are a product-mix transition story, and the difference matters. The cleaning business that built the company and carried 72% of revenue a year ago is declining. The growth is entirely from electroplating and advanced packaging categories that are lower-margin in their ramp phase, capital-intensive, and dependent on customer qualification cycles that are extending. Gross margin compressed to 46.0%, inventory swelled to $783 million with $288 million in finished goods sitting at customer sites, and free cash flow is deeply negative at -$120 million trailing twelve months.

The key issue is not whether electroplating and advanced packaging will grow. They will. The more important question is whether ACM Research can execute the transition from its legacy cleaning cash engine to a multi-product portfolio without extending the cash-burn period or compressing margins below the 42% floor. The supply chain constraint—component lead times stretching from four to six months—adds timing risk to revenue recognition. The $300 million in U.S.-held cash provides runway but does not change the underlying cash-flow trajectory.

The stock is up 112% year-to-date and 243% on a rolling annual basis. That run has priced in a smooth transition. If SPM cleaning ramps as expected in H2 2026, if ECP and packaging margin profiles stabilize, and if acceptance delays do not push significant revenue into 2027, the thesis holds. If the cleaning decline persists longer than management expects, or if supply chain constraints delay shipments and compress margins further, the valuation multiple will face pressure. The structural bet is on execution during transition, not on demand.
